You can manually advance Destinations (or any AddOn for that matter) to the latest API version.
Simply open Destination.txt (in the root folder of the AddOn) in a text editor and change the APIVersion variable to the latest API version (Currently 100018).
WARNING: This only suppresses the warning messages, this will NOT fix any errors an AddOn might have
